Transaction 38111926291cd61550f0fb953d2df783aac797d0e1fd17aec37209d8c2b70cbd
1 Input
1 Output
-
38111926291cd61550f0fb953d2df783aac797d0e1fd17aec37209d8c2b70cbd:0
- value
- 2580802
- script pubkey
- OP_0 OP_PUSHBYTES_20 3cfec7af3e8be38de726b4a9ea3f7b5c1812434b
- address
- bc1q8nlv0te7303cmeexkj5750mmtsvpys6tgtkmf8